The Duties Of A Magical Girl

The Duties of a Magical Girl

A few people have asked me what I would consider to be valid work for a magical girl. In a similar vein, I’ve seen a lot of folks here struggle with the idea of ‘concepts’ and feeling that they need to conform to a preconceived notion of what magical heroes do.

This post has been a long time coming but I think I’m finally feeling confident about what I want to convey here. If you’ve been waiting on this, thank you so much for your patience and I hope it helps you in your journey!

This post is part of my Magi Praxis series. If you have any suggestions for future topics, or you have attempted anything I have shared and want you share your experiences, please send me a message! I am always happy to go back and provide further explanation as well. ☆

The Duties Of A Magical Girl

While tasks like tracking down Labyrinths and vanquishing evil entities seem to be almost standard for many magical girls, these by no means define what it means to be a magical hero. I would also go so far as to say that you do not need to transform, whether that would be physically or astrally, to be a magical girl.

Our jobs boil down to a simple idea: to make the world a better place. How we then decide to go about that is what ultimately makes our individual approaches and practices unique.

While a statement like ‘making the world a better place’ can seem grandiose and unachievable, we can decide to start smaller or on a more personal level. Realistically, it may be more feasible and responsible to approach your work in a way that makes the world better for you, your friends and family, or your communities.

We do not all need to tackle big, existential problems through our magical duties—especially if you’re just starting out on your journey. Focus on making the world happier, more welcoming, and more habitable for you. This may take the form of self-care, confidence boosting, or glamours through the use of magia. You can also do this through volunteer work, community building, and mutual aid; I often find that helping others helps me with my complicated feelings of confidence and self-worth.

This is not to say that the astral battles and the like aren’t worthwhile, but they should be done with the goal of making our world and communities better—however you envision that to be.

KITCHEN WITCHERY

Kitchen witchery is a versatile and easy form to bring magick into your daily life. It is a warm, nurturing and down-to-earth way to practice magick and it is a fantastic path to try if you are broom closeted and need to keep your craft secret or outwardly invisible to others.

It defines every kind of magickal working that combines cooking, baking or culinary mixing and witchcraft. You could even stretch the definition as far as to include magickal crafting or work that is done in the kitchen.

Kitchen witchery can be performed in two different ways:

food rituals;

kitchen magick.

Birthdays and weddings are considered a food ritual because of the cake and candles  – it is a means of happiness, good luck and for your wish to come true. It is about eating together and the celebration of the event that is taking place. Witches usually have celebratory meals when it comes to Sabbaths.

Kitchen magick is the practice of manipulating the energy that’s around us and in the food, making an intention known and trying to have it manifested.

Food is a magickal tool that can help you in immense ways!

A kitchen witch is someone that practices their witchcraft in the kitchen and weaves their magick into the food they prepare. 

There are different types of kitchen magick, such as:

ENERGETIC MAGICK

Energetic magick is all about infusing food with energy and intention. This can be done through meditating on or visualizing a certain outcome, feeling an emotion or goal that will be worked into the food.

Common ways to do so is to stir it with a wooden spoon or simply mindfully blessing a meal.

RUNE, SYMBOL AND SIGIL MAGICK

Rune, symbol and sigil magick usage is a common way to work magick in the kitchen. This can be done by drawing them into pie crusts, bread and stirring them into sauces or into your morning coffee. You can also draw, carve or burn them on your cooking tools for different goals. This way you can draw a specific intention into your food.

MAGICKAL HERBALISM

You can infuse your morning coffee with magic ingredients, like cinnamon or vanilla, and stir it with intention.

MEDICINAL HERBALISM

If you are working with spells of health and healing, it is worth looking into herbs as they not only have magickal properties, but also medical.

INTENTIONAL COOKING

It is important to choose the method that resonates with you and your needs. Make your kitchen a space where you feel comfortable and at ease.

Every act of cooking and preparation can be infused with magick and carry energetical significance – for example, washing your hands and ingredients can be used to cleanse negative energies or anything undesirable.

Kitchen witchery is free and not fixed, so you don’t really need anything. A lot of witches love using tools, such as:

cups, bowls and pots possess loving energies. Rounded pots and bowls are generally associated with Goddess energy, as they were most commonly used to feed and nourish others in older times – they hold and contain sacred food, which is our key to life. Pots are associated with The Great Mother.

        Element: Water;

the oven is seen as a symbol of the Divine, as well as transformation. Ovens have been used in various forms for many years and thus are preferable to newer inventions like microwaves when magickally cooking.

        Element: Fire;

plates and platters generally represent the Physical world, money and abundance. They are ruled by the Sun.

        Element: Earth;

spoons are mini bowls on handles, so they strongly correlate with bowls.

       Element: Water;

forks are sacred, as they are the main tool for eating. They are ruled by Mars.

       Element: Fire;

knives are associated with life and death, as knives can be used to bring about both stabbing and cutting food to eat. They are ruled by Mars.

       Element: Fire.

💗Lovely offerings to Aphrodite💗

Roses: all roses are sacred to Her.

Dark chocolates: known to be an aphrodisiac

Vanilla: organic is best

Sweet fruits: especially apples

Seashells: of all kinds

Sand: collected from the beach if possible

Seawater: if you don’t live near the ocean, make your own saltwater for Her

Olive oil: olive oil is liked by many deities

Golden honey: honey is another liked gift by many gods

Sweet perfumes: offer Her the whole bottle or wear some as a devotional act

Poems and hymns: make them about Her or about someone you love

💗Sweet devotional acts💗

Practice self-care and self-love

Feeding birds, bees, and fish and taking care of nature

Dancing

Enjoying the beauty of the world

Masturbate in Her name if you feel comfortable doing so

Music, either your own or a playlist that reminds you of Her

Remember to tell the ones you are close to your love

Do a little extra for yourself - a spa day, new clothes, go a little extra on your makeup even if it is just a normal day for you, etc.

💗Cute altar ideas💗

An altar to Aphrodite should be as beautiful as you can make it. Decorate it with ocean motifs, roses (real or fake), flower garlands, nods to Her sacred animals (doves, swans, dolphins,) art of Her or erotica, rose quartz, pearls, and bright colors that capture feelings of love and the sea. An altar beside a window, on a windowsill, a vanity stand, or somewhere with a mirror. If you need to keep it secret or wish to keep a travel altar, try to keep her altar in a pretty box adorned with floral or sea decorations or something like a makeup pouch.

Having an outdoor garden altar is also a perfect option for Her - make it bird and bee friendly, use organic products (ones without pesticides) on your plants, have bird-feeders around, and have a little place where you can safely light a candle or incense for Her along with an offering bowl and a place for you to sit and enjoy the beauty she brings to you.

Ares Offerings

Ares Offerings

"Ares is the Olympian God of war, battlelust, courage, and civil order."

Large Altars:

Strong, dark red wine

Strong whiskey

Pure water

Black coffee

Black tea

Olive oil

Beef

Red meats in general

Cooked fat from meats

Blood from cut meats

Heavy spices

Spicy foods

Garlic

Frankensince

Sandalwood incense

Red, black, and dark purple candles

Art or statues of Him

Statues of horses or dogs

Weapons, armor, and shields (art, statues, toys, handmade, etc.)

Trophies

Small/Hidden Altars:

Spicy jerky

Sport drinks / protein shakes

Hand drawn or printed art of Him

Art or images of dogs, horses, and vultures

Feathers from vultures, woodpeckers, or barn owls

Red crystals such as garnets, rubies, bloodstone, etc.

Iron or steel jewelry

Red flowers, like roses

Thorns

Miniature or toy weapons and armor, especially helmets

Snake skin

Animal teeth

Write down your fears or successes and give them to Him

Medals and ribbons you've earned

Antiques

Photos of riots or past wars

Devotional Acts:

Create a playlist and listen to music that makes you feel brave/empowered

Donate to the Rape Crisis Center or other similar programs

Donate and support victims of war

Cook with garlic or heavy spices that you haven't tried before

Try new things and don't feel ashamed about doing so

Tell Him about your accomplishments

Tell Him about your fears

Learn about shadow work and try it for yourself

Learn about history, past wars, and past riots. Learn what they accomplished or failed to accomplish

Learn and educate yourself about the downsides of war and what can happen to the people affected by wars

Take care of your mental health by going to therapy, eating, drinking enough water, and remembering to take your medication

Partake in combat sports like martial arts, fencing, etc.

Exercise, find some fun workouts to do!

Play some strategy games like chess, Risk, Civilization, etc.

Stand up for yourself and what you believe in, write to your governor/mayor for things you want to see changed, attend riots, etc.

At the same time, don't push yourself if your physical or mental health isn't well, He doesn't want His devotees injured

A good place for His altar would be at the front door of your house or bedroom as He was considered to be the frontline of protection.

Pray to Him for strength, ability to fight and defeat enemies, courage, to keep others safe, and help in a battle.

Tarot Basics

What is tarot?

Tarot is a method of divination. It is used as a tool to project and unravel our inner self, our thoughts and feelings. Each tarot card symbolises something different. When seen together in a reading, they tell a story. This story relates to our lives and can influence the way we see our future.

How do the cards work?

There are 78 cards in a tarot deck. 56 of the cards are part of the ‘Minor Arcana’ and the other 22 are part of the ‘Major Arcana’.

Each card in the Major Arcana represents a stage in the journey from ignorance to wisdom. They represent different archetypes and which archetypes are in play for each reading. The cards are part of a progression and therefore it’s important to remember where each card comes from and where it goes.

The 56 cards of the Minor Arcana deal with specifics rather than the big picture. Once again, each card represents a point in a pathway. However, unlike the Major Arcana, the Minor Arcana is spilt into 4 suits and therefore there are 4 paths.

What are the cards of the Major Arcana?

The Fool, The Magician, The High Priestess, The Empress, The Emperor, The Hierophant, The Lovers, The Chariot, Strength, The Hermit, The Wheel of Fortune, Justice, The Hanged Man, Death, Temperance, The Devil, The Tower, The Star, The Moon, The Sun, Judgement and The World.

What are the cards of the Minor Arcana?

There are four suits in the Minor Arcana. They are the Wands, the Cups, the Swords and the Pentacles. Each suit has the cards 2-10 as well as an Ace, a Page, a Knave/Knight, a Queen and a King.

What do the suits represent?

The Wands represent creativity, desire and will. Their realm is physical. Their element is fire. They are active.

The Cups deal with emotions, relationships and love. Their realm is spiritual. Their element is water. They are receptive.

The Swords represent reason, logic, action and intellectual endeavours. Their realm is spiritual. Their element is air. They are active.

The Pentacles relate to worldly things: the body, finances, sensuality. Their realm is physical. Their element is earth. They are receptive.

How do I get a tarot deck?

You can be gifted one, you can buy one or you can make one. It’s up to you.

Are tarot decks oracle decks?

No. Tarot decks and oracles decks are both methods of divination but they are not the same. Neither is better than the other; you’ll just have to see what you prefer.

How do I bond with a deck?

You can sleep with it, interview it, shuffle it or just use it.

Traveling Witchcraft

As I’m beginning to plan for my future, my girlfriend and I agree upon one thing: we want to travel. We want to buy a bus and go just about everywhere. But if my life is spent on the road how do I fit in witchcraft? Well, here’s my four R’s.

• Research! Research about where you’re going. Find out about the history, plant life, animal life, weather, etc.

• Respect. Don’t even think about practicing anything from a closed culture that’s not yours. Respect the local wildlife. Remember that you are merely a visitor. If you’re performing a spell somewhere don’t leave anything behind (including energy) pick up and cleanse after yourself. The list goes on but just remember your manners.

• Resourcefulness! You don’t need super expensive tools to practice witchcraft. Travel altars, homemade tools, and the like are just as powerful!

• Routine. Start a routine you can take with you anywhere. Meditation, visualization, affirmations, gratitude, and so many other tools will help you create an routine that you can keep with you wherever you go.
